The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.

In the 1881 Census, the household of John Shewan, born in 1810 in St Fergus, Aberdeenshire, consisted of 11 members. John was the head of the household, widower. He had 3 children; Elizabeth (born 1857 in St Fergus, Aberdeenshire, Scotland), William (born 1859 in St Fergus, Aberdeenshire, Scotland) and James (born 1863 in Aberdeenshire, Scotland).
During the period, also present in the household were John's Visitor, Elizabeth (born 1827 in Old Deer, Aberdeenshire, Scotland), John's Visitor, Helen J (born 1857 in Marnoch, Banffshire, Scotland), John's Servant, Isabella (born 1860 in Kincardineshire, Scotland), John's Servant, Margaret (born 1864 in Aberdeenshire, Scotland), John's Servant, Charles (born 1853 in Braemar, Aberdeenshire, Scotland), John's Servant, John (born 1861 in Keig, Aberdeenshire, Scotland) and John's Servant, William (born 1866 in Peterhead, Aberdeenshire, Scotland).
